AFC Urgent Care Southcenter seeks an experienced, independent, and patient-focused Provider to deliver high-quality, efficient medical care in a busy, multi-service urgent care environment. This position is ideal for a confident clinician capable of working autonomously while collaborating closely with the clinic’s leadership team to uphold clinical excellence and patient satisfaction.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ities- Provide comprehensive urgent care, occupational medicine, and minor primary care services.
- Perform physical examinations, diagnose, and treat acute and chronic medical conditions.
- Conduct and interpret diagnostic testing including X-rays, EKGs, and point-of-care lab tests.
- Perform minor procedures such as wound care, suturing, incision and drainage, abscess management, and splinting.
- Conduct occupational health exams including DOT physicals, pre-employment, post-accident, and return-to-work evaluations.
- Participate in the management of employer accounts, ensuring compliance with company protocols.
- Accurately document all patient encounters in the EMR (Experity) in real-time to ensure proper coding and billing compliance.
- Collaborate with the Assistant Medical Director and Medical Director to enhance workflow efficiency, staff training, and clinical quality.
- Provide guidance and support to medical assistants and front-desk staff in patient care coordination.
- Adhere to HIPAA, OSHA, and Washington State Department of Health regulations.
- Maintain a professional, compassionate, and patient-centered approach at all times.
